Aw, not even close!  I followed my three steps.  But the portlet still shows up 
in the list under Portlets in the Administration Portlet.  Then I deployed my 
portlet again.  No errors, but no portlet window either.  Off to the 
Administration Portlet to create an instance and add a portlet window to a 
page.  No errors while doing that.  Then log off and back in and go to that 
page.  Errors galore.  So it would appear that there is no way to actually 
delete a portlet. (Well, if you follow my three steps the portlet will at least 
not cause problems, at least not until your attempt to deploy it again.)

However, redeploying an existing portlet seems to work just fine.  That is, 
don't do any steps to remove the portlet.  Just change the porlet and its 
configuration and redeploy (with < if-exists > set to overwrite) and the 
changes are applied.
